Body poetry won the Second Prize in the last edition of the Ceramic International Contest in Alcora. The work has been recognised for its “highly conceptual language,” centred on notions of social critique that approach self-portraits and reveal the manipulation of the body to attempt to conform to established norms and ideals. The jury also highlighted the combination of diverse techniques, including moulds, screen-printed decal transfers, photography, and blown glass, within an approach akin to collage, remarking both a strong technical ability and a magnificent capacity for integration.

This edition of the competition featured significant participation, with 321 ceramic artists (200 international and 121 national) submitting a total of 472 works. From these, 42 pieces were selected for the CICA 2026 exhibition, which will be on view at the Museu de Ceràmica de l’Alcora from 15 May to 6 September 2026.
